Bindapter use the power of DataBinding to build a flexible RecyclerView.Adapter which will save you a lot of time.
Bindapter is totally built with Kotlin + Love 💖.
Only create your view using databinding
<layout xmlns:android="http://schemas.android.com/apk/res/android">
<data>
<variable
name="item"
type="com.example.app.Item"/>
</data>
<TextView
android:id="@+id/img"
android:layout_width="match_parent"
android:layout_height="wrap_content"
android:text="@{item.title}"/>
</layout>
Then create your Bindapter
val adapter = Bindapter<ItemModel>(R.layout.item_view, BR.item)
And then set it to your RecyclerView
recyclerView.adapter = adapter
As simple as that, now you can spend your time on more important things

If you want to add interaction in your views you just have to add a Handler
(or whatever you like name it) class when you create a Bindapter:
class Handler {
fun onClick(view: View) { ... }
fun onClickImage(view: View, item: ItemModel) { ... }
}
val bindapter = Bindapter<ItemModel>(R.layout.item,
itemVariableId = BR.item,
handler = Handler(),
handlerId = BR.handler)
public class Handler {
public void onClick(View view) { ... }
public void onClickImage(View view, ItemModel item) { ... }
}
Bindapter<ItemModel> bindapter = new Bindapter<>(R.layout.item,
BR.item,
new Handler(),
BR.handler);
This way you can use it in your layout.
<layout xmlns:android="http://schemas.android.com/apk/res/android">
<data>
<variable
name="item"
type="com.example.app.Item"/>
<variable
name="handler"
type="com.example.app.Handler"/>
</data>
<ImageView
android:id="@+id/img"
android:layout_width="match_parent"
android:layout_height="wrap_content"
android:onClick="@{handler::onClick}"
app:imgUrl="@{item.image}"/>
</layout>
If you need to receive the model when an item is clicked, you can implement it this way:
<ImageView
android:id="@+id/img"
android:layout_width="match_parent"
android:layout_height="wrap_content"
android:onClick="@{(view) -> handler.onClickImage(view, item)}"
app:imgUrl="@{item.image}"/>

A binding adapter is a way to define custom behaviors to set properties in a view. For example, load images with Glide/Picasso or set TextView's color according to a model property. More info
The sample app contains a file named BindingAdapters.kt
. This is the way you have to define them; just creating Kotlin file an put the functions there.
@BindingAdapter("imgUrl")
fun loadImage(imageView: ImageView, url: String) {
Glide.with(imageView.context)
.load(url)
.into(imageView)
}
@BindingAdapter("ratingColor")
fun ratingColor(textView: TextView, ratingPercent: String) {
val percantage = ratingPercent.toInt()
val context = textView.context
val color = when {
percantage > 95 -> ContextCompat.getColor(context, R.color.positive_1)
percantage > 90 -> ContextCompat.getColor(context, R.color.positive_2)
else -> ContextCompat.getColor(context, R.color.negative)
}
textView.setTextColor(color)
}
If you are using Java you just have to define your binding adapters as static methods.
@BindingAdapter({"bind:imgUrl"})
public static void loadImage(ImageView view, String url) {
Picasso.with(view.getContext()).load(url).into(view);
}
Once it is declared you can use it in your layout:
<ImageView
android:id="@+id/img"
android:layout_width="match_parent"
android:layout_height="wrap_content"
app:imgUrl="@{item.image}"/>
- My BR. class/variables are missing ¿What can i do?
The BR class isn't correctly generated yet. After define your layout you have to build again your project
- There is a problem building the project: 'Internal compiler error'
It's possible you have commit a mistake in your layout file defining types with Data Binding. Check your gradle console to know where exactly is the problem.
